Posted by Tai on August 08, 2005 at 12:59:21:

Hello everyone, I hope someone out there can offer me some advice. I recently purchased a home that is unfinished. In our contract there was a list of things that had to be done by the sellers before we took ownership of the house. Most of it got done, but there are still a few things on the list that have not been finished yet and we have been here for over a month now. I have talked to the seller (who continually tells me to go talk to a neighbor who is supposed to get it done, but he is very unreliable), I have talked to the sellers real estate agent (who I believe spoke with the seller, but it has been a week already and no one has contacted us), and I have talked to my agent (who talked to her broker and was told just to talk with the sellers agent). It seems like these things are never going to get done and I was wondering what kind of legal action I can take if things do not get finished soon. Any help would be wonderful, thank you all in advance!
